DOTC-PCG: Four Korean nationals and four Filipinos were rescued by passing fishermen after their motorbanca capsized while navigating between Danao and Camotes Island during the height of Tropical Storm Basyang.
The unnamed boat was reportedly rented by the Koreans last January 31 and departed Santiago, San Francisco, Camotes Island. While underway to Danao, the boat was battered by big waves caused by the inclement weather, thereby causing it to capsize.
The following day at around 11:30AM, a certain Calvin Tuadles, together with the Danao City Rescue Team, informed Coast Guard Sub-Station (CGSS) Danao that a fisherman identified as Ramil Sanchez rescued the three Koreans onboard said boat at the vicinity waters of Barangay Looc, Danao.
According to Sanchez, his boat can only accommodate three persons, thus, he had to leave the five passengers in the water and proceeded to Barangay Looc. The survivors were then brought to Danao City District Hospital for treatment of minor rashes.
Upon receipt of said report, the personnel of CGSS Danao dispatched an aluminum boat, a Special Operations Unit (SOU)-Cebu rubber boat and PCG search and rescue vessel, BRP EDSA II (SARV 002) to conduct surface search and immediately render assistance in the search and rescue operation for the remaining passengers.
On the same day, CGSS Camotes received a phone call from CGSS Danao informing that the five passengers were already rescued by passing fishermen at Barangay Malbago, Esperanza, San Francisco, Cebu. Immediately, CGSS Camotes proceeded to said barangay to confirm the report.
Investigation conducted with fishermen Oliver Formentera and Allan Gonzaga revealed that while on fishing venture, they sighted four individuals clinging on a half-submerged motorbanca at the vicinity seawaters off Malbago and immediately rescued said persons and turned over to Australia Reston, Councilor of said Barangay.
Meanwhile, Mario Soringa, another passing fisherman sighted another person drifting along with improvised floaters at the same vicinity. The victim was also turned over to Mr. Reston.
The survivors were rushed to Maningo Memorial Hospital in San Francisco, Cebu for proper medical attention.
After the medication, SOU-Cebu rubber boat ferried the two survivors to BRP EDSA II (SARV-002) which departed Nagub-an, Union, San Francisco bound for Danao City. Meanwhile, the four crew members preferred to stay since they are natives of Camotes Island.
CGSS Danao, together with the Danao City Rescue Team, immediately proceeded to the said barangay to render necessary assistance. Thereafter, the team provided medical assistance and conducted interrogation to said rescued victims.
